Over 500 Native Applications for iPhone & iPod touch Available at Launch

CUPERTINO, Calif., July 10 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Apple(R) today announced that more than 500 native applications will be available on the iPhone's App Store when Apple's iPhone(TM) 3G goes on sale tomorrow. Apple's iPhone provides a breakthrough mobile platform for developers, who have created an incredible array of innovative applications such as stunning action games, advanced medical applications and robust productivity tools for the enterprise. These apps will be available on Apple's revolutionary new App Store, enabling customers to wirelessly download them directly onto their iPhones and start using them immediately. More than 125 applications are being offered to iPhone customers for free.

The new iPhone 3G combines all the revolutionary features of iPhone with 3G networking that is twice as fast*, built-in GPS for expanded location-based mobile services, and iPhone 2.0 software which includes support for Microsoft Exchange ActiveSync and runs hundreds of third party applications available through the new App Store which is a built-in application on every iPhone running iPhone 2.0 software.

'iPhone represents a new software platform for developers, combining the most advanced mobile operating system, sophisticated developer tools and a breakthrough way for developers to wirelessly sell and distribute their applications right onto every iPhone,' said Philip Schiller, Apple's senior vice president of Worldwide Product Marketing. 'The reaction from developers has been very, very positive and we're opening the App Store with over 500 native iPhone applications available for immediate purchase and download.'

Many of these amazing new applications also take advantage of iPhone's large display, Multi-Touch(TM) user interface, fast hardware-accelerated 3D graphics, built-in accelerometer and location-based technology to bring far more powerful applications to the mobile arena than ever before.

The App Store on iPhone works over cellular networks and Wi-Fi, which means it is accessible from just about anywhere, so users can purchase and download applications wirelessly and start using them instantly. Applications are free or charged to the user's iTunes(R) account and the App Store notifies the user when updates are available for their apps.
